lnc-31 Interacts with Rock1 mRNA and Mediates Its YB-1-Dependent Translation
Schematic representation of lnc-31 mode of action. In proliferating myoblasts (left), lnc-31 promotes the translation of Rock1 through the binding of its mRNA and the inhibition of proteasome-mediated YB-1 degradation. In myotubes (right), the poor levels of lnc-31 are not sufficient to sustain such activities leading to the downregulation of Rock1 expression. This loop would be further reinforced by the upregulation during myogenesis of miR-152, making it possible to establish robust negative control of Rock1 expression.
